Fashion Sketchbook will get you started drawing clothing. 9 Heads will help you to learn how to draw the human body and it has a wide range of poses you can practice. There are two books that are frequently used by fashion illustrators to learn their craft, those being 9 Heads: A Guide To Drawing Fashion by Nancy Riegelman and Fashion Sketchbook by Bina Abling. It is necessary to be able to capture the spirit of a design along with its precise lines, look, and dimension, and to be able to play with proportion and other aspects of art in order to achieve a desired look. Technical skills in drawing and painting are also critical for fashion illustrators.
